zoukankan      html  css  js  c++  java
  • Java—常量和变量

    • 关键字

      Java中有特殊用途的词被称为关键字,关键字服务大小写。

      

    • 标识符

      标识符是用于给java程序中的变量、类、方法等命名的符号。

      标识符的几条规则:

    1. 由字母、数字、下划线(_)、美元符号($)组成,不能包含特殊字符,不能以数字开头。
    2. 不能是Java关键字和保留字,但可以包含关键字和保留字,如:void不合法,但Myvoid合法。
    3. 严格区分大小写。
    • 变量

      通过三个元素来描述变量:变量类型、变量名、变量值。

      变量命名的规则:驼峰命名法、见名知意、区分大小写,如:myAge、stuName。

      变量的使用规则:

    1. 需要先声明后使用。
    2. 可以声明变量的同时进行初始,如:String love = "java";或者:String love;love = "java";
    3. 变量每次只能赋一个值,但可以修改多次。
    4. main方法中定义的变量必须先赋值,然后才能输出。
    5. 变量名不建议使用中文,跨平台操作时会出现乱码。
    • 数据类型

      Java是一种强类型语言,而且必须在编译时就确定其类型。

      

      基本数据类型存的是数据本身,引用数据类型存的是保存数据的空间地址。

      

      float型变量赋值时在数值后添加字母f。

      char型变量赋值时使用单引号(')引起来,String型变量赋值使用双引号("),如:Sting name = "张三";Char sex = '男';

    • 自动类型转换
    int score1 = 82;
    double score2 = score1;
    System.out.println(score2);

      运行结果为:82.0

      条件:目标类型与源类型兼容,如:double兼容int型,但是char型不能兼容int型。目标类型大于源类型,如:double类型可以存放int型,但是反过来就不可以了。

    • 强制类型转换

      语法:(数据类型)数值

      强制类型转换可能会造成数据的丢失,要慎用。

    • 常量

      常量是一种特殊的变量,它的值被设定后,在程序运行过程中不允许改变,一般用大写字符。

      语法:final 常量名 = 值;如:final String LOVE = 'java';

    • 注释

      

      

      使用文档注释时还可以使用 javadoc 标记,生成更详细的文档信息:

           @author 标明开发该类模块的作者

           @version 标明该类模块的版本

           @see 参考转向,也就是相关主题

           @param 对方法中某参数的说明

           @return 对方法返回值的说明

           @exception 对方法可能抛出的异常进行说明

     

      可以通过javadoc 命令从文档注释中提取内容,生成程序的API文档,

    D:javaProgram>javadoc -d doc Hello.java
    正在加载源文件Hello.java...
    正在构造 Javadoc 信息...
    正在创建目标目录: "doc"
    标准 Doclet 版本 1.8.0_65
    正在构建所有程序包和类的树...
    正在生成docHello.html...
    正在生成docpackage-frame.html...
    正在生成docpackage-summary.html...
    正在生成docpackage-tree.html...
    正在生成docconstant-values.html...
    正在构建所有程序包和类的索引...
    正在生成docoverview-tree.html...
    正在生成docindex-all.html...
    正在生成docdeprecated-list.html...
    正在构建所有类的索引...
    正在生成docallclasses-frame.html...
    正在生成docallclasses-noframe.html...
    正在生成docindex.html...
    正在生成dochelp-doc.html...

      在浏览器中打开首页,如:file:///D:/javaProgram/doc/index.html

      

  • 相关阅读:
    spring mvc文件上传,request对象转换异常
    解决国内android sdk无法更新,google不能的简单办法
    1.5 高速找出机器故障
    图的深度优先搜索与广度优先搜索
    我对ThreadLocal的理解
    Leetcode--3Sum
    <转>Openstack Ceilometer监控项扩展
    怎样利用WordPress创建自己定义注冊表单插件
    java_免费视频课程汇总
    HDU 3641 Pseudoprime numbers(快速幂)
  • 原文地址:https://www.cnblogs.com/tianxintian22/p/6417295.html
Copyright © 2011-2022 走看看